    DB Browser for SQLite

    DB Browser for SQLite

    The DB Browser for SQLite

    ...Import and export records as text, import and export tables from/to CSV files, import and export databases from/to SQL dump files, issue SQL queries and inspect the results, examine a log of all SQL commands issued by the application, plot simple graphs based on table or query data.

    Outdated! Only works for Firefox 3.0-3.2. ff3hr is a forensic tool to recover deleted history records from Firefox 3. FF3 uses various SQLite databases to store the history, and this tool can recover records from different tables in an disk image.
